Mechanistic Insights Into Luminol Chemiexcitation: The Role of the Amide Carbonyls
By means of quantum‐chemical calculations, we demonstrate that the 1,2‐dioxin ring forms following nitrogen release from parent luminol. We also identify alkoxide groups derived from the amide carbonyls of luminol as key enhancers of the chemiexcitation yield.

Cell Blocks and the Milan System for Reporting Salivary Gland Cytopathology: A Meta‐Analysis
ABSTRACT Background The Milan System for Reporting Salivary Gland Cytopathology (MSRSGC) is a classification system first released in 2018. It provides a standardized categorization for salivary gland lesions. Cell blocks can be prepared from fine‐needle aspirations (FNAs) and can be utilized for the diagnostics of salivary gland lesions.

Micro‐QuEChERS sample preparation coupled to LC‐QQQ‐MS enabled sensitive quantification of nitazene analogs in 100 μL of plasma. The validated method provided low detection limits and was successfully applied to an authentic intoxication case involving N‐pyrrolidino protonitazene, supporting clinical and forensic toxicology workflows.
